25 March 2020 – Commuting on the Hungarian-Romanian border will be possible again

Overview: PÈter Szijj·rtÛ said that it had been agreed with his Romanian colleague that commuting would be possible again on the border of Hungary and Romania, within a 30-kilometer radius of the border, for those working on the other side of the border.
